Lt. Gen. (ret) Walter E. Piatt serves as chief executive officer of Wounded Warrior Project ® (WWP). He brings 42 years of military experience and leadership to the organization. Piatt oversees day-to-day operations and works with the leadership team to set and implement the organization’s strategic vision. He is responsible for ensuring WWP ...

Wounded Warrior Project ( WWP) is an American charity and veterans service organization that operates as a nonprofit 501 (c) (3). WWP offers a variety of programs, services and events for wounded veterans who incurred a physical or mental injury, illnesses, or co-incident to their military service on or after September 11, 2001.
